Simple Train Exchange
after Sam Loyd
Two trains, one of an engine and a car and another - of an engine and two
cars, meet at a segment of railroad. There is a switch or side-track on
that segment of railroad - just as shown in the illustration. The switch
is large enough only to hold one engine or one car at a time.
The object is, using only this switch, to exchange the trains in order
they can continue their journeys and do that in the most expeditious way.
No other outside help, except the switch itself, is allowed. Please, note
that a car cannot be connected to the front of an engine.
